作者热门文章
- objective-c - iOS 5 : Can you override UIAppearance customisations in specific classes?
- iphone - 如何将 CGFontRef 转换为 UIFont?
- ios - 以编程方式关闭标记的信息窗口 google maps iOS
- ios - Xcode 5 - 尝试验证存档时出现 "No application records were found"
我最近看到一个网站在他们的页面中使用了谷歌翻译,但他们没有使用小部件,而是通过链接列出了可用的语言。单击一个链接,它会翻译页面。
有人做过吗?我试图通过页面解析来弄清楚它是如何完成的,但我没有看到与我使用小部件时有什么不同。这是我的一些代码:
<h3>Translate</h3>
<ul class="google-translate-six">
<li><a href="?/#googtrans(en|es)" title="View this site in Spanish.">Español</a></li>
<li><a href="?/#googtrans(en|zh-CN)" title="View this site in Chinese.">中文</a></li>
<li><a href="?/#googtrans(en|it)" title="View this site in Italian.">Italiano</a></li>
<li><a href="?/#googtrans(en|pl)" title="View this site in Polish.">Polskie</a></li>
<li><a href="?/#googtrans(en|ht)" title="View this site in Haitian Creole.">Kreyòl Ayisyen</a></li>
<li><a href="?/#googtrans(en|pt)" title="View this site in Portuguese.">Português</a></li>
<li><a href="?/#googtrans(en|en)" title="View this site in English.">English</a></li>
</ul>
<script type="text/javascript">
function googleTranslateElementInit() {
new google.translate.TranslateElement({
pageLanguage: 'en',
autoDisplay: false,
gaTrack: true,
gaId: 'wewe',
layout: google.translate.TranslateElement.InlineLayout.SIMPLE
}, 'google_translate_element');
}
</script>
<script src="//translate.google.com/translate_a/element.js?cb=googleTranslateElementInit"></script>
谢谢!我指的网站是:https://www.baltimorecountymd.gov/index.html .翻译部分位于页面的右下角。
谢谢大家!
最佳答案
我相信this page是你要找的。
关于javascript - 谷歌翻译使用链接点击,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46711869/
我是一名优秀的程序员,十分优秀!